Output 725574927e7480134a0340add5c142274bda82e04bee8b56e6f22dd3180aec59:0

value
755828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ae2df3f04563f4d55d836aeb93610e6aa52145f OP_EQUAL
address
3EMNxN1jmbyhJizkE2oeGYK5tbTuUxcWo1
transaction
725574927e7480134a0340add5c142274bda82e04bee8b56e6f22dd3180aec59